What is Cinchy?

Cinchy is the pioneering platform for data collaboration aimed at enterprises, utilized by heavily regulated entities like banks, credit unions, and insurance firms to implement numerous innovative technologies, such as enhanced customer experiences and advanced analytics, in significantly reduced timeframes. Its unique network-based architecture empowers clients with complete oversight of their data, signaling the most significant evolution in enterprise technology deployment since 1979. As the world's first autonomous data fabric, Cinchy's design mimics the functionality of the human brain, effectively rendering data silos and traditional integration methods obsolete by treating data as a cohesive network. This innovative approach is being adopted by some of the most intricate organizations, particularly within the financial sector, enabling them to streamline and mitigate risks associated with transitioning from an application-centric model to a data-centric one. Consequently, organizations can achieve greater agility and responsiveness in addressing their operational needs.
